Results from the PSI-Center Interfacing Group

POSTER

Abstract

The Interfacing Group of the Plasma Science and Innovation Center (PSI--Center --- http://www.psicenter.org) facilitates simulations of collaborating Innovative Confinement Concept (ICC) experiments. Present collaborating experiments include the Bellan Plasma Group (Caltech), FRX--L (Los Alamos National Laboratory), HIT--SI (Univ of Wash --- UW), LDX (M.I.T.), MBX (Univ of Texas--Austin), MST, Pegasus (Univ of Wisc--Madison), PHD (UW), SSPX (Lawrence Livermore National Laboratory), SSX (Swarthmore College), TCS (UW), and ZaP (UW). NIMROD code meshes have been created and/or modified for the Caltech, SSX, and LDX experiments. Simulations of the Caltech and SSX experiments study formation and buildup of electrode-driven helicity injection. LDX simulations study stability of marginally-stable equilibria as additional heating increases pressure gradients. NIMROD output files are interfaced to the powerful 3-D viewer, VisIt (http://www.llnl.gov/visit), which will be demonstrated. Results from these simulations, as well as an overview of the Interfacing Group status will be presented.
